Output 2912e158266376ff7167ef2a6863dc8280b06e3256a59092144acad365bc3a78:31

value
8388608
script pubkey
OP_0 OP_PUSHBYTES_20 c6b360523ae18ca5dde2e4bbf1fefbfc5e849df7
address
bc1qc6ekq536uxx2th0zujalrlhml30gf80htcukds
transaction
2912e158266376ff7167ef2a6863dc8280b06e3256a59092144acad365bc3a78
spent
true